Pumpkin had dental work

My dog Pumpkin had his teeth cleaned yesterday. At first, I hesitated to have the vet clean my dog's teeth because I didn't want him anesthetized. He's 13 years old and I didn't want to take any risks. After talking to our veterinarian we decided to have it done.

The veterinarian told us that just like people, good dental care is extremely important to a dog's overall health. Dental tartar accumulates on the dog's teeth and provides a home for bacteria, which can cause gum disease. Untreated dental disease is not only painful but can lead to other problems such as kidney disease and sinus infections. Therefore, getting your dog's teeth cleaned is an important health care item and should not be ignored.

Pumpkin had one loose tooth extracted in addition to getting his teeth cleaned. He is home now doing fine.
